programme:
09.15 registration and coffee
09.30 introduction: defining intranet objectives: asking the why, what,
how questions
before looking at how we get internal support for the
intranet project, it is important to ensure that you can clearly explain
what is you are expecting the intranet project to achieve in terms of
objectives, measurements and strategy
10.30 understanding your audiences and their needs
too often intranets are associated with technology issues
and not business issues. this section looks at how you decide who the
audience is you are selling to (in terms of budgets, use and support) and
how you communicate to meet their needs
11.00 coffee
12.30 building the business case and who to sell it to
this will look at what the business case will need to cover,
how to build a financial justification and how to build a technical
justification. the issue of who to sell the messages to will also be
examined
12.45 lunch
13.45 creating an organisational structure to support your intranet
having received approval to create the intranet, what type
of structure is required to build, support and enhance it. this will look at
the relationship between it and the business and examine different
empowerment models for supporting content on the intranet
14.30 evolving the intranet
intranets should be treated as living and evolving. this
evolution should cover not only updates to existing content, but also new
content and an evolution towards an e-business solution for the organisation
15.15 tea
15.30 workshop - creating good practice
this workshop will split the delegates into groups and ask
them to come up with how they would solve issues associated with ensuring
the organisation is supportive of the intranet strategy, including:
* how to measure success
* how to communicate success
* how to get people using the intranet
16.15 action planning and summary
a summary of the content including a roadmap of how to move
forward
